Where is the Ticknor publishing house in Boston?(give a different answer) .
You mean the famous Ticknor & Fields publishing House? The one that published thoreau, Emerson and Hawthorne? well, this doesn't exist anymore my friend :) The only thing that's left from this "institution" is the building that housed it , the Old Corner Bookstore. it's on the corner of School and Washington streets.
